    I'm thinking of creating a ghost/monster costume that looks like a fake prop, but is really me dressed up (fairly standard bait-and-switch idea), except that I am going to be hiding in a black light area of our yard haunt. I have bought black light contacts (in yellow) and some black light paint for my teeth (I'm going to use it on my dental distortions teeth). But what I'm looking for is what you think will be the most effective costume.
    I was thinking of maybe one of those lame white ghost costumes that are basically a sheet with the eyes cut out (wouldn't need the teeth for this) and wearing all black underneath (including gloves), then putting hand holds for my arms, so they can rest, as well as a prop of some sort for in front of my feet (say a rock?).
    Do you think that would be effective? Can you think of other/better ways to conceal me in plain site until I pounce? I'm thinking that the contacts will make my eyes look fake (since most people's eye don't glow). I was also considering moving in a FCG manner and then suddenly moving forward.
    Or do you think another type of monster entirely would work better? Say....a black light clown? Sitting hunched on a chair until pouncing???
    Any input/suggestions/ideas are appreciated! thanks

    what's your goal?

    shock (jump out as say boo!) or disturbing (let their little minds slowly build into overdrive before you say boo!) or just creepy (running around in the front yard randomly)?

    i prefer disturbing... like Jaws... let them know their up the creek with the music and the lights... then come alive at the last minute and watch them flee.

    the UV contacts will have a HUGE effect if they don't see them until they are too close. im thinking of the basement scene from salem's lot myself... so corpse, zombie, vampire... just play dead. wait until they are good and (way too) close - then open the eyes and grin like your going to have the best dinner of your un-life... thats just me.

    you might be able to whip up a prop to match yourself for the bait and switch bit (always fun). and just a personal first love - open coffins could go really far here.

    makeup should be non-UV reactive - just for the wild, day-and-night contrast when you open your eyes and mouth. if nothing else is fluorescing the UV will make everything rather dark - then... when they are close enough that you can smell the bubblegum... open your eyes, grin like an idiot, and hiss or groan or some such nonsense, while reaching for the Tot's... even if you never left the coffin - it would scary the rice krispies out of me!
